Cats lay on clothes for some of the same reasons that they lay on your chest. If you’ve ever found your cat napping on top of your freshly laundered clothes, you’re probably wondering why they do it. Clothes are also a warm, comfy place to sleep. Cats are known for their love of soft, cozy spots, and your clothes may provide a comfortable resting place for. According to vets, cats probably like to lie on your clothes as a way of spreading their scent or seeking comfort. They may be marking your clothes with their scent so that other animals know you are claimed by a cat. According to a pet behaviorist, cats may be more likely to lay on clothes that carry the scent of their owner, such as those that have been. Another reason why cats like sleeping on our clothes could be related to their instincts as kittens.
